Telecom - Services — Top 14 Stocks by Mutual Fund Conviction

# Stock Name No. of MFs Holding Avg Weight (%) Total MF Value (Cr)
1 Bharti Airtel Limited 592 funds 3.88% ₹125,909 Cr
2 Indus Towers Limited 208 funds 1.43% ₹14,132 Cr
3 Bharti Hexacom Limited 136 funds 0.81% ₹6,059 Cr
4 Tata Communications Limited 118 funds 0.89% ₹8,426 Cr
5 Vodafone Idea Limited 95 funds 1.11% ₹1,281 Cr
6 RailTel Corporation of India Limited 49 funds 0.24% ₹31 Cr
7 HFCL Limited 44 funds 0.60% ₹114 Cr
8 Tata Teleservices (Maharashtra) Limited 37 funds 0.08% ₹14 Cr
9 Route Mobile Limited 11 funds 0.22% ₹107 Cr
10 STL Networks limited 3 funds 0.11% ₹30 Cr
11 Vindhya Telelinks Limited 2 funds 0.15% ₹215 Cr
12 Pace Digitek Limited 2 funds 0.83% ₹159 Cr
13 Mahanagar Telephone Nigam Limited 1 funds 0.00%
14 City Online Services Ltd** 1 funds 0.00%

What Do Mutual Funds Hold in the Telecom - Services Sector?

The table above ranks the top 14 stocks in the Telecom - Services sector by the number of Indian mutual fund schemes holding them as of May 2026. When a large number of fund managers independently choose the same stock, it is a powerful signal of institutional conviction — these are the stocks that professional money managers believe in most.

What does fund count tell you?

A stock held by 200+ mutual funds means that hundreds of fund managers — each doing their own independent research — have concluded that this stock deserves a place in their portfolio. This collective wisdom is one of the most reliable indicators of a stock's quality within its sector. The average weight shows how much of their portfolio each fund typically allocates to the stock, and the total MF value shows the combined rupee investment across all funds holding it.
